In Oklahoma bad faith insurance claims, punitive damages are capped in one of two ways: either (1) $100, 000 or the amount of compensatory damages awarded; or (2) $500, 000 or the increased financial benefit derived by the Insurance Company as a direct result of its bad faith conduct. While a cause of action for breach of contract is brought to obtain contract damages, such as the value of benefits under the policy, bad faith can be a tort claim that permits an insured party to obtain damages beyond the value of the insurance claim.
